Thai Restaurant Restaurant Review: Baltimore's oldest Thai restaurant is still going strong, pumping out comfort food, Thai-style, in a pleasant, easy-going atmosphere. There's nothing too taxing amidst its roster of curries, noodles and stir-fries, which is not to say that the seasoning is always bland: the larb neua, a hot-and-sour beef salad, will flame your eyebrows. But for the most part, the food is as moderate in its firepower as it is easy on your wallet. House specialties include pad woon sen, a bean-thread dish laced with pork, shrimp and squid, and yum ked koong, hot-and-sour shrimp with mixed mushrooms. Worried about parking? There’s a small private lot out back. |
